Auggie Pass

Auggie Pass Information

The Auggie Pass is an all-you-can ride transit pass for eligible Augsburg students. This includes all rides on Metro Transit Twin Cities buses and light-rail trains. Students can also ride Northstar Commuter Rail between Target Field Station and Anoka Station. Traveling to Northstar stations north of Anoka requires additional fare, which can be added to the Auggie Pass as stored value.

All undergraduate day students who pay the semester Green Fee are eligible for the Auggie Pass. All other students (Adult Undergraduate, Graduate) can still purchase a College Pass in the bookstore for $165 per Fall & Spring semesters and $65 for the Summer semester.

The Auggie Pass is valid for the Fall and Spring semesters of the academic year. The exact dates will be published closer to the start of the Fall semester.

Day students can pick up the Auggie Pass at the Library Circulation Desk – bring your Augsburg ID

The Auggie Pass is valid on:

  • All local and express bus routes operated by Metro Transit, Minnesota Valley Transit Authority (MVTA), Southwest Transit, Maple Grove Transit, and Plymouth Metrolink.
  • Arterial Bus Rapid Transit (aBRT) routes A Line and C Line.
  • All METRO lines – Green Line, Blue Line, and Red Line.
  • Northstar Commuter Rail between Anoka Station and Target Field Station.

The Auggie Pass does not cover travel on Metro Mobility, Transit Link, Southwest Prime, Northstar Link, or the University of Minnesota Campus Connector. If you are a student who uses Metro Mobility, Augsburg will provide you with a Go-To card to cover your rides, similar to the Auggie Pass.

Students must tap their Auggie Pass on every trip, including transfers. For more information about tapping your pass, visit https://www.metrotransit.org/fares.
